**Onboarding: HueCheck audit access**

Welcome to the Brindleworth contrast audit. HueCheck scans each page of the Lantern UI and flags text failing our contrast thresholds. Before running your first scan, configure the CLI with credentials scoped to the audit project only — never reuse personal tokens. Your assigned contractor key appears below.

gateway credential: kto23_LX9A4ys6i4nzHtpOLNLodKK

If you're on call and need to tail logs, use `murkline`, our little internal CLI. It pulls from the Saltgrove aggregator and respects your on-call scopes automatically. Every release of murkline is built through the Copperfen provenance pipeline, so you can verify exactly which commit and builder produced your binary. The provenance trace token for the current release is shown below.

build token for tawip-yageg: htk9_92ac43d42

**Handover note — intern arrivals**

Morning Priya — the Larchfield intern cohort (nine of them) arrives Tuesday at 09:30. I've booked the Fernside Room for inductions and printed the welcome packs; they're in the cupboard behind reception. Lanyards are sorted, but temporary passes aren't activated until HR signs off, so for day one they'll need the visitor door code.

turnstile pass: bdg-NG-3

CI note: font vendoring failures on Brindlecote pipeline

If the asset stage fails with a checksum mismatch, it's usually the vendored Glimmerhand font bundle drifting from the lockfile. Re-run the vendor script, commit the refreshed lockfile, and rerun only the asset stage — a full rebuild wastes an hour. The last green run that vendored fonts correctly is recorded below.

session token of tajef-bageg = htk21_5d90d574934f3ccae6437